On the occasion of the centenary of Pier Paolo Pasolini's birth, the MEG invites you to discover a little-known aspect of his work: the compilation of Italian popular poetry. In addition to the reading of some poems, you will have the pleasure of discovering recently acquired Sicilian puppets.
Speakers: Andrea Carlino, Associate Professor, Institute of Ethics, History and Humanities, Federica Tamarozzi, Curator, Head of the Europe Department and Floriane Facchini, author and director
